Mario’s Mumbai
Artists have a knack for capturing people and places in a way words and images can’t. If you find this statement hard to believe, one glance at artwork by Mario de Miranda should be enough to convince you. The legendary cartoonist never had a formal art education, and yet, between strokes, he brought the essence of a burgeoning city like Mumbai alive.

His legacy today is carried forward through the Mario Gallery that offers a range  of his work on objects ranging from collectibles like figurines and coasters, to crockery. And if you live and breathe the city, you can get your hands on a stunning lampshade with an illustrated map of the city on it. The sketch is printed on high-impact polystyrene and the lampshade is available as both, a hanging and standing variant. There’s also a fun cube where you can manipulate sections to form scenes like that of a packed local train.
